Description
Kazuhe Nomomiya, a boy who was given a gifted education from otaku parents. One morning in the kitchen he saw a mysterious vortex that changes his fate. A boy nurtured as an otaku, instantly recognizes that it is summoning magic. What does the future hold, for the boy who rushed to the vortex at full speed… A 16-year-old boy who loves otaku subculture goes to a different world.
